11: /*
12: floating point Bessel's function
13: of the first and second kinds
14: of order zero
15:
16: j0(x) returns the value of J0(x)
17: for all real values of x.
18:
19: There are no error returns.
20: Calls sin, cos, sqrt.
21:
22: There is a niggling bug in J0 which
23: causes errors up to 2e-16 for x in the
24: interval [-8,8].
25: The bug is caused by an inappropriate order
26: of summation of the series. rhm will fix it
27: someday.
28:
29: Coefficients are from Hart & Cheney.
30: #5849 (19.22D)
31: #6549 (19.25D)
32: #6949 (19.41D)
33:
34: y0(x) returns the value of Y0(x)
35: for positive real values of x.
36: For x<=0, if on the VAX, error number EDOM is set and
37: the reserved operand fault is generated;
38: otherwise (an IEEE machine) an invalid operation is performed.
39:
40: Calls sin, cos, sqrt, log, j0.
41:
42: The values of Y0 have not been checked
43: to more than ten places.
44:
45: Coefficients are from Hart & Cheney.
46: #6245 (18.78D)
47: #6549 (19.25D)
48: #6949 (19.41D)
49: */

144: static void asympt();
145:
146: double
147: j0(arg) double arg;{
148: double argsq, n, d;
149: int i;
150:
151: if(arg < 0.) arg = -arg;
152: if(arg > 8.){
153: asympt(arg);
154: n = arg - pio4;
155: return(sqrt(tpi/arg)*(pzero*cos(n) - qzero*sin(n)));
156: }
157: argsq = arg*arg;
158: for(n=0,d=0,i=8;i>=0;i--){
159: n = n*argsq + p1[i];
160: d = d*argsq + q1[i];
161: }
162: return(n/d);
163: }
164:
165: double
166: y0(arg) double arg;{
167: double argsq, n, d;
168: int i;
169:
170: if(arg <= 0.){
171: #if defined(vax)||defined(tahoe)
172: return(infnan(EDOM)); /* NaN */
173: #else /* defined(vax)||defined(tahoe) */
174: return(zero/zero); /* IEEE machines: invalid operation */
175: #endif /* defined(vax)||defined(tahoe) */
176: }
177: if(arg > 8.){
178: asympt(arg);
179: n = arg - pio4;
180: return(sqrt(tpi/arg)*(pzero*sin(n) + qzero*cos(n)));
181: }
182: argsq = arg*arg;
183: for(n=0,d=0,i=8;i>=0;i--){
184: n = n*argsq + p4[i];
185: d = d*argsq + q4[i];
186: }
187: return(n/d + tpi*j0(arg)*log(arg));
188: }
189:
190: static void
191: asympt(arg) double arg;{
192: double zsq, n, d;
193: int i;
194: zsq = 64./(arg*arg);
195: for(n=0,d=0,i=6;i>=0;i--){
196: n = n*zsq + p2[i];
197: d = d*zsq + q2[i];
198: }
199: pzero = n/d;
200: for(n=0,d=0,i=6;i>=0;i--){
201: n = n*zsq + p3[i];
202: d = d*zsq + q3[i];
203: }
204: qzero = (8./arg)*(n/d);
205: }
